About The Dewberry:

As a 2022 Cond Nast Traveler Gold List award recipient for best hotel in the world, The Dewberry is located in the heart of downtown Charleston, bordering historic Marion Square, just steps from the shopping and dining on King Street, Museum Mile and The Gaillard Center. Offering 154 thoughtfully appointed rooms, world-class service and unparalleled views, The Dewberry occupies the former L. Mendel Rivers (circa 1964) federal building and pays homage to Charleston's century architectural splendor. The hotel is the result of owner John Dewberry's vision of "Southern Reimagined," which he developed over the course of an eight-year renovation and preservation of the building. The hotel features several event spaces, the nationally celebrated cocktail program at the brass bar in The Living Room, the whimsical cocktail lounge Citrus Club, and treatments at our urban oasis, The Spa.
